Overview
- Government accounts cite over 11.5 crore household toilets built under SBM-Grameen and more than 4.7 lakh villages now declaring ODF Plus status.
- Urban solid-waste processing is reported at 81%, up from about 16% in 2014, with more than half of legacy waste remediated and land reclaimed.
- A Nature paper estimated 60,000–70,000 infant deaths prevented each year, and WHO attributed 300,000 diarrhoeal deaths averted between 2014 and 2019.
- UNICEF findings report 93% of women feeling safer at home due to improved access to sanitation facilities and expanded community participation.
- Current commentary emphasizes Phase II priorities such as behavior change, waste-to-wealth initiatives, local governance leadership, technology adoption, and better protections for sanitation workers.
